Choosing the Right Cordless Vacuum for Pet Hair Removal
Understanding Suction Power & Performance
The most crucial factor when selecting a cordless vacuum for pet hair is suction power. Measured in kPa (kilopascals) or Air Watts, higher numbers generally indicate stronger suction. For stubborn pet hair embedded in carpets, aim for a vacuum with at least 50KPA. However, suction isn’t everything. A well-designed brush head and airflow system are equally important. Vacuums with “Hurricane” or “Turbo” modes offer a temporary boost in power for particularly challenging messes. Consider that higher suction settings will reduce runtime.
Runtime & Battery Considerations
Runtime directly impacts how much you can clean on a single charge. A runtime of 30-60 minutes is generally sufficient for most homes, but consider your home’s size and the amount of pet hair. Look for vacuums with removable batteries. This allows you to purchase extra batteries for uninterrupted cleaning or to easily replace a worn-out battery down the line. Battery capacity (measured in mAh) is a good indicator of potential runtime, but remember that suction mode significantly affects how long the battery lasts.
Brush Head Design: Anti-Tangle Technology
Pet hair is notorious for wrapping around brush rolls, reducing cleaning effectiveness and requiring frequent manual removal. A V-shaped brush head combined with anti-tangle comb technology is a game-changer. These designs actively prevent hair from wrapping, saving you time and effort. Some models also feature flexible brush heads that can maneuver around furniture and into tight corners more effectively.
Filtration Systems & Air Quality
For allergy sufferers or those concerned about air quality, a robust filtration system is essential. Look for vacuums with HEPA filters (High-Efficiency Particulate Air) capable of capturing 99.97% of particles as small as 0.3 microns. Multi-cyclonic filtration systems further enhance performance by separating dust and debris before they reach the filter, prolonging its life and maintaining suction. Some advanced models even include features like aromatherapy tablets to freshen the air while you clean.
Additional Features to Consider
- Dust Cup Capacity: Larger dust cups (1.5L+) mean less frequent emptying.
- LED Headlights: Illuminate hidden dust and debris, especially under furniture.
- Smart Displays: Provide real-time information on battery life, suction mode, and error alerts.
- Self-Standing Design: Convenient for pausing cleaning without needing a support.
- Attachments: Crevice tools, dusting brushes, and pet hair tools expand versatility.
- Weight & Ergonomics: Lighter vacuums are easier to maneuver, especially for extended cleaning sessions.
